what does the mean represent in a set of numbers? a the middle number b the average number c the number the appears most often d the highest number

Answer

Brief Explanations:

The mean of a set of numbers is calculated by summing all the numbers in the set and dividing by the number of elements in the set, which is the definition of the average. The middle - number is the median, the number that appears most often is the mode, and the highest number is just the maximum value in the set.

Answer:

B. the average number
